Toronto Battles MI Gov. on Trash, Wants Zero Waste by 2010

Toronto’s mayor, Mel Lastman, wrote to U.S. President George Bush on March 14, asking him to intervene in the tug-of-war between Michigan and Toronto over the city’s garbage. Toronto has decided to solve its trash removal problem by eliminating trash altogether.
